@whoisearth@lemmy.ca in technology · Apr 04, 2026
It’s interesting because I was talking to my psychologist about this last week. Mental illness runs in my extended family specifically my best friend is a functional alcoholic. He grew up the son of a functional alcoholic. We all agree that alcoholism is an addiction, just like gambling, social media, etc. The problem is that as a society we are addressing the specific addiction. AA for alcoholics. For gambling the government has programs you can admit yourself to. What I was postulating to my psychologist is the real problem is some people have un underlying susceptibility to addiction. My experience with addicted people is regardless of good or bad if you remove an addiction they will replace with an unhealthy obsession on something else. Alcohol will be replaced with something else because the problem is the person has an imbalance they can’t do something in moderation. I’ve seen this time and time again. Plus factor in comorbidities like ADHD and you have a stew going. My point being, yes you’re correct tech is a problem, but it’s 100% the people too in some cases it’s just without the social media their addiction may have been benign so not visible. “Oh look at Mary with her beanie baby collection.” Or “oh look at Jack he really is a go getter running his 10k rain or shine every day.”
